About IDinsight 

IDinsight is a mission-driven global advisory, data analytics, and research organization that helps global development leaders maximize their social impact. We tailor a wide range of data and evidence tools, including randomized evaluations and machine learning, to help decision-makers design effective programs and rigorously test what works to support communities. We work with governments, multilateral agencies, foundations, and innovative non-profit organizations in Asia and Africa. We work across a wide range of sectors, including agriculture, education, health, governance, sanitation, and financial inclusion. We have offices in Dakar, Lusaka, Manila, Nairobi, New Delhi, and remote. For more information, please visit idinsight.org.

About Digital Economy Research Impact Initiative (DERII)

The Digital Economy Research Impact Initiative (DERII) is a five-year initiative (funded by the Gates Foundation) to study the digital economy and its welfare implications on gig workers using platforms that provide location-based services in three countries – India, Kenya, and Indonesia.
